Daniella Muyangayanga

I am a Ph.D. student in Anthropology at FSU. I earned my undergraduate degree from the Catholic University of Bukavu in the Democratic Republic of the Congo. My research interests are at the intersection of social practices, culture, human–animal interactions, and emerging infectious diseases, with a particular focus on zoonotic diseases. I examine how cultural practices and socio-ecological environments shape vulnerability to infectious diseases, as well as understanding patterns of disease transmission, prevention, treatment, and community response. My research focuses particularly on Ebola virus disease and dengue fever among vulnerable populations and rural communities. Through this work, I aim to support public health programs in designing effective interventions that respond to the specific social, cultural, and environmental contexts of affected communities
